[Css] a: hover fails to set the upper and lower borders under ie6 and ie7. hoverie7
I found this problem when writing styles some time ago. Although this bug was solved at that time, I still kept a record to avoid this problem again.

Through the demo, we can find that in ie6 and ie7 browsers, only the left and right borders are displayed when the mouse moves up and down borders, while other browsers are normally displayed. Why?
Because the hasLayout attribute of a label in ie6 and ie7 is false, What Is hasLayout? I will not talk about Baidu here.
Now that we know the problem is hasLayout, we only need to set hasLayout. There are many methods to set it. Below are two common methods:
a:hover{position:relative;}a:hover{zoom:1;}

In ie, 80% of bugs are caused by the absence of hasLayout in the element. If you encounter an undefinable problem in ie, the first thing to do is to add hasLayout to the element.
